3 - Medicare Part B Flashcards
Medicare’s Medical Insurance is a _______ program.
-Voluntary
Medicare Part B has an annual deductible for 2018 of _____ which must be met before Medicare Part B pays.
-$183
Medicare Part B also has a ________ blood deductible coordinated with Medicare Part A.
-3 pint annual
Medicare Part B will generally pay ____ of Medicare “approved charges.”
-80%
Physicians and Suppliers that do not accept assignment are referred to as nonparticipating and may charge an _______ above the Medicare Part B approved amount.
-excess amount of 15%
Any physician who provides services that the physician knows or has reason to believe Medicare will determine to be medically unnecessary and will not pay is required to provide the Medicare Beneficiary with a document called an ______________).
-Advance Beneficiary Notice (ABN)
The typical Medicare Beneficiary participating in Medicare Part B pays _____ of the cost of his or her Medicare Part B premium.
-25%
In 2018, the standard Part B premium amount will be ______.
-$134
Failure to enroll (or continue enrollment) in Medicare Part B during the Initial Enrollment Period will result in an additional ______ of premium for each full ______ delayed enrollment from the end of the individual’s Initial Enrollment Period (IEP)
- 10%
- 12 months
Medicare will pay for mental health services with a _____ coinsurance for outpatient services and _____ coinsurance for inpatient services.
- 40%
- 20%
During the first twelve (12) months that a Medicare Beneficiary has Medicare Part B, he or she can get a ________ preventive care visit.
-“Welcome to Medicare”
Yearly Wellness exams are provided if the Medicare Beneficiary has Medicare Part B for longer than ______. There is no charge for this exam if the physician accepts assignment. This exam is covered once every twelve ______.
- 12 months
- 12 months
Individuals enrolling in Medicare Part B during 2018, not eligible for a special enrollment period, and earning up to ___________ will have a monthly premium of $134.00.
-$85,000
